Responsibilities
  • Review patients lists prior to visit and ensure all supplies/equipment are available for all patients.
  • Arrive on time, check in with dental contact, and review list of patients to be seen.
  • Transport, set-up and take down equipment and supplies in room designated as workspace by facility.
  • Work with contacts at nursing home to coordinate transfer or patients and their chart to and from the treatment room. If issues with transport of patients/charts and all options have been exhausted, call clinical support manager for assistance.
  • Perform required care including taking X-rays, cleaning teeth and dentures, applying sealants, assess patient’s oral heath to report finding to dentist, following all ADA and Company standards of care.
  • Explain procedures as they are completed to patient. Follow up with staff at facility to review recommendations for patient.
  • Enter chart notes for treatment provided into Salesforce at the time of treatment.
  • Ensure that OSHA safety and cleanliness regulations are followed during patient treatment.
  • Ensure that disposables are handled correctly before leaving facilities.
  • Check out with dental contact at facility, including review of chart notes. Leave printed copies of chart notes with facilities for patient charts.
  • Work with clinical support manager on schedule and follow up of patient care and treatment.
  • Maintain dental equipment through regular cleaning and maintenance routines.
  • Inventory supplies and order as needed.
  • Follow regulated OHSA guidelines in handling and sterilization of instruments.
  • Utilize personal vehicle for equipment/supply transport and traveling to scheduled facility visits.
  • Be available via cell phone during workday.
  • Willing and able to expense purchases for office needs, unforeseen supply purchases and other reimbursable business-related expenses.

Aria Care Partners provides on-site healthcare services for seniors in long-term care facilities, including dental, vision, and hearing care tailored to aging patients. Clinicians visit facilities regularly under contract, so residents receive care without traveling and services integrate into daily routines. The company differentiates itself by focusing on senior-specific health needs (like hearing loss and dementia), paired with compassionate service and scalable, tech-enabled partnerships. Its goal is to improve health outcomes and quality of life for elderly residents by delivering reliable, on-site care within their care communities.

PR Newswire Today at 8:10am PDT OVERLAND PARK, Kan., March 18, 2026 /PRNewswire/ - Aria Care Partners, a leading provider of dental, vision, hearing, and podiatry services to skilled nursing facilities (SNF), announced that it has acquired Coronado Dental, based in Chandler, Arizona. Since 1994, Coronado has been offering mobile onsite dental care to approximately 75 SNFs throughout Phoenix and Tucson. Its suite of preventive, restorative, and emergency services are provided by a dedicated care team that includes dentists, dental hygienists, dental assistants, and community managers. This acquisition establishes Aria's first presence in Arizona and builds on the company's recent expansion including the previously announced acquisition of Sanford Dental, Sanford Vision, and Dynamic Mobile Dentistry, which significantly expanded its service footprint in the Southeast. To help ensure continuity of care for current SNF customers, Aria will retain Coronado's client-facing team. Facilities will also gain access to expanded dental benefits, along with Aria's onsite vision, hearing, and podiatry services and insurance offerings. These programs support Aria's broader commitment to expanding access to coordinated, onsite care for skilled nursing communities. Coronado Dental operations will be merged into Aria's to enable enhanced support in administrative functions, technology, and care delivery. Aria maintains strong medical leadership over its programs through a Chief Clinical Officer and experienced Chief Medical Officers in each specialty. "Geographic growth is a strategic priority for our company as we bring our proven care model to SNFs across the country," said John Griscavage, CEO of Aria Care Partners. "Coronado Dental is a respected provider that aligns well with our strategy and approach to onsite ancillary care." Added Coronado owner Davis Henning, DDS, "This move opens exciting new opportunities to increase value for our skilled nursing communities." OVERLAND PARK, Kan., Feb. 26, 2026 /PRNewswire/ - Aria Care Partners, a leading provider of dental, vision, audiology, and podiatry services to skilled nursing facilities (SNF), announced that it has acquired Sanford Dental, Sanford Vision, and Dynamic Mobile Dentistry (collectively Sanford). Headquartered in Macon, Georgia, they provide onsite dental and vision care to approximately 200 SNFs across Georgia and Alabama. Sanford also offers dental insurance plans for residents. The acquisition significantly expands Aria's footprint in the Southeast and furthers the company's ongoing growth initiatives. Sanford's operations will be integrated into Aria's for enhanced administrative and technology support. Current Sanford SNF customers will experience strong continuity of care, as Aria is retaining Sanford's care providers, account staff and other client-facing teams to minimize any disruption for residents or facility staff. Skilled nursing facilities will also gain access to expanded onsite services, including Aria's optometry, audiology and podiatry offerings, providing the convenience of vendor consolidation many organizations are seeking. Customers will also benefit from Aria's established care infrastructure, which includes experienced Chief Medical Officers in each specialty, oversight from a Chief Clinical Officer and extensive technology, administrative and compliance support for its medical professionals. In addition, residents will have new opportunities to enroll in Aria's expanded dental coverage as well as its vision and hearing plans. "Sanford is an excellent fit with our program and brings a strong track record serving SNF communities in Georgia and Alabama," said John Griscavage, CEO of Aria Care Partners. "We look forward to adding value for those communities and growing our position as a premier provider in the region." Added Sanford CEO John Neel, "We are enthusiastic to be joining forces with Aria Care Partners. Our customers will be the beneficiaries of expanded service capabilities and offerings." Aria Care Partners hires Terra Gray McClelland as VP of government relations

Aria Care Partners, a provider of dental, vision, audiology and podiatry services to skilled nursing facilities, has appointed Terra Gray McClelland as Vice President of Government Relations. The newly created role will see McClelland lead federal and state government relations strategy as the company expands nationally. McClelland brings extensive experience, most recently serving as Director of State and Local Government Affairs at McDonald's Corporation. She previously held the position of Vice President of Government and External Affairs at Benevis, where she worked on Medicaid issues affecting providers and patients. In her new role, McClelland will engage with government officials, represent the company before regulatory boards, and advocate for legislation improving specialty care access in skilled nursing facilities. Aria Care Partners currently serves over 3,000 facilities across the United States.
